Manufacturing is a large employing industry. Around 5.9% of workers have their main job in this industry.
Manufacturing involves transforming materials, substances or components into new products like:
- food and beverages
- textiles, leather, clothing and footwear
- wood and paper products
- petroleum and coal products
- chemical, polymer and rubber products
- mineral and metal products
- machinery and equipment
- furniture and other products.
Median earnings are $1,654 per week, lower than all industries median earnings of $1,741.

Sectors
Bakery Product Manufacturing is the largest sector in the Manufacturing industry, employing 64,200 workers.

Occupations
Structural Steel and Welding Trades Workers is the largest employing occupation in the Manufacturing industry.
The 10 largest employing occupations are shown below.
Some occupations are common across a number of industries.
Largest employing occupations
| ANZSCO Code | Occupation title |
|---|---|
| 3223 | Structural Steel and Welding Trades Workers |
| 1335 | Production Managers |
| 8321 | Packers |
| 3232 | Metal Fitters and Machinists |
| 3941 | Cabinetmakers |
| 7411 | Storepersons |
| 8311 | Food and Drink Factory Workers |
| 6211 | Sales Assistants (General) |
| 7213 | Forklift Drivers |
| 1311 | Advertising, Public Relations and Sales Manager |
